What is PAR?
Progressive Aboriginal Relations (PAR) is an online management and reporting program that supports progressive improvement in Aboriginal relations, and a certification program that confirms corporate performance at the bronze, silver or gold level. If a company is a leader in Aboriginal relations, PAR certification recognizes the commitment and success.
4 Drivers of PAR
Leadership Actions - Company leaders support an organizational focus on progressive Aboriginal relations across the company, such actions have an impact in achieving and sustaining positive results.
Employment - The company commits resources to achieving equitable representation of Aboriginal persons in the workplace.
Business Development - The company commits resources to the development of business relationships with Aboriginal-owned businesses.
Community Relations - The company commits to develop and sustain positive relations with Aboriginal communities, members and stakeholders through engagement and investment.
